the hazeltine scent company terre bonne candle celebrates the seasonal abundance of south louisiana with notes of spanish moss, petrichor, bald cypress, and spiderlily.
top notes: petrichor, cypress leaf
heart notes: duckweed, clover, aquatic lilies
base notes: oakmoss, papyrus
9 ounces / 255 grams
approximately 40 hours of burn time
it is made of coconut wax. made in the united states.

unit price perthe frank lloyd wright imperial hotel 2-in-1 sliding wood puzzle includes both a puzzle and a game. side 1 is a tile puzzle featuring wright’s imperial hotel bronze floor plate design and side 2 is the numbers challenge known as “game of fifteen”. to play “game of fifteen”, the 16th tile is removed. the player slides the tiles (without lifting them off the surface) to match the multiple number sequence challenges provided on the instruction sheet. the tiles are only lifted up to move when the player is stuck and wants to revert to the starting configuration for a new challenge.
- box size: 7 x 7 x 1.8”, 180 x 180 x 46 mm
- 2 piece box
- wood tray holds 16 wood tile pieces
- side 1: full color tile puzzle
- side 2: game of fifteen

when grief first arrives, it is like an elephant-so big that there is hardly room for anything else. but over time, grief can become smaller and smaller-first a deer, then a fox, a mouse, and finally a flickering firefly in the darkness leading us down a path of loving remembrance.
this lyrical work is an empathetic and comforting balm for anyone who is experiencing grief, be it grieving the loss of a loved one or losses in the world around us.
reassuring feelings book: children can often feel confused by their emotions. the gentle voice and soft illustrations in this book help to make these emotions feel less frightening, and the hopeful ending provides a reassuring message that grief will transform over time.
#1960now captures the ongoing fight for equality, from the 1960s civil rights movement to the black lives matter movement today. through striking black-and-white photographs by shelia pree bright, this powerful collection juxtaposes portraits of past and present social justice activists, highlighting the courage and conviction of both ’60s elder statesmen and today’s new generation of fighters. this collection offers a sobering reminder that the struggle for justice is far from over, while showcasing the enduring spirit of resistance.
• features documentary images from recent protests alongside portraits of iconic figures from the 1960s civil rights movement.
• visually compares the activism of the 1960s with the black lives matter movement of today.
• an important contribution to american protest photography and a stark reminder of the continuous fight for justice and equality.

centered offers a rich, inclusive, and contemporary look at design diversity, both past and present, through essays, interviews, and images curated by design educator and advocate kaleena sales. as the design industry challenges its eurocentric foundations and reassesses conventional practices, centered highlights the voices, places, methods, ideas, and beliefs that have been overshadowed or excluded by dominant design movements. with thirteen thought-provoking essays and interviews, this volume features underrepresented and impactful design work, both historical and contemporary.
• includes works such as gee's bend quilters by stephen child and isabella d'agnenica and a chinese typographic archiveby yujune park and caspar lam.
• features an interview with sadie red wing (her shawl is yellow) on indigenous sovereignty and design.
• explores diverse and often overlooked design movements like the truck art of india by shantanu suman.
